
We're Michael and Dena — and like a lot of dog parents, we spent years watching the same scene play out. Find a place you love. Get excited. Scroll to the fine print. Not pet friendly.
Back to searching.
We weren't looking for a place that tolerated our dogs. We wanted somewhere that actually wanted them there — oceanfront, well-designed, thoughtful — where the dog bed wasn't an afterthought shoved in a corner and the pet fee didn't feel like a punishment for loving your animal.
That place didn't exist. So we built it.
Salty Paw Rentals started with one Schnauzer, one condo, and a pretty simple belief: your dog is family, and family doesn't get left behind.
Today we have two oceanfront properties at Patricia Grand Resort in Myrtle Beach — Lil' Salty on the 7th floor and The Salty Monkey on the 15th — and every single detail in both of them was chosen with you and your dog in mind. The welcome kit. The balcony setup. The dog bowls. The bed you'll actually want to sleep in. The view you won't want to leave.
We think about the things you didn't know to ask for — because we've been the guest who needed them.
This isn't a side hustle dressed up as a dog-friendly rental. It's personal. It's the vacation we always wanted to take, and now we get to share it.
Come stay. Bring the dog. Enjoy every moment.
